Which is most likely the result of millions of metal atoms crowding together so that molecular orbitals become combined?
the loss of metallic properties
the formation of bands in a crystal
the loss of valence electrons to other atoms
the formation of localized valence electrons

the formation of bands in a crystal
When many atoms come together, their atomic/molecular orbitals overlap and split into a continuum of closely spaced energy levels, forming energy bands (conduction and valence bands) characteristic of solids. This also leads to delocalized (not localized) valence electrons and metallic behavior.
